Family announces sad passing of Deaconess Naomi Essien

She was 84years old

Family announces the passing of Deaconess Naomi Essien after a brief illness, highlighting her life of faith, service and enduring legacy

The family of Chief Mfonobong Essien has announced the passing of Deaconess Naomi Mfon Essien, 1941 to 2025, following a brief illness.

The passing of Deaconess Naomi Essien was confirmed in an official statement signed by Chief Essien and made available to Freelanews, which described her as a devoted mother, grandmother, great grandmother and respected matriarch.

The family said late Deaconess Essien lived a life marked by deep faith, kindness and consistent service to her community.

She was widely regarded for her calm strength, humility and the enduring values she instilled in everyone who encountered her.

Deaconess Essien was the mother of Dr Mary Ade Fosudo, an accomplished professional in Business Support and the founder and Managing Director of Fosad Consulting. Dr Ade Fosudo has built a reputable career supporting blue chip and multinational organisations across different sectors.

Relatives noted that Deaconess Naomi Mfon Essien leaves behind children, grandchildren, great grandchildren and extended family members who cherish the blessing of her long and impactful life.

They described her legacy as powerful and inspiring, emphasising the profound influence she had on her family and community.

The family stated that burial arrangements will be announced in due course.

May her soul rest in peace.
